STRAWBERRY-LEMONADE ANGEL PIE
This strawberry, cream, and meringue confection is so gorgeous, it can take the place of any floral centerpiece on your table. It's similar to a pavlova, but the meringue base is formed into a pretty shell and the strawberry filling is cooked with a little gelatin to make this stunner sliceable.
Provided by Sarah Carey
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Pie & Tarts Recipes
Time 6h20m
Yield Serves 8 to 10
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Crust: Preheat oven to 300°F with a rack in center. Lightly brush a 9-inch pie dish with butter. Beat egg whites and cold water on high speed until foamy, about 30 seconds. Add cream of tartar and continue to beat until soft peaks form, about 1 minute. Gradually add sugar and beat until thick, glossy peaks form, about 5 minutes.
- Spread meringue into an even layer along bottom and up sides of prepared pie dish to form crust. (Don't spread past rim, or it will fall over edges during baking.) Bake until crisp and light golden on outside, 40 to 45 minutes. Turn off oven and let cool in oven 1 hour, then transfer to a wire rack and let cool completely.
- Filling: Meanwhile, add enough water to lemon juice to yield 1/2 cup (about 2 tablespoons plus 1 teaspoon). Combine gelatin and 1 tablespoon lemon mixture in a small bowl.
- In a medium saucepan, combine sugar, 2 cups strawberries, and salt. Using a potato masher, gently mash berries.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ce heat to medium-low and simmer, stirring frequently, until mixture is juicy, about 5 minutes. Whisk cornstarch into remaining lemon mixture; stir into pan with berries and return to a boil.
- Cook until liquid is very thick and clear, about 1 minute. Stir in gelatin mixture, reduce heat to low, and cook, stirring, until gelatin is fully dissolved, 30 seconds. Remove from heat and let cool 5 minutes. Stir in remaining berries and pour into cooled crust. Refrigerate until set, at least 3 hours or, covered, up to 1 day. Top with whipped cream and whole or halved berries just before serving.
UPSIDE-DOWN LEMON MERINGUE PIE
Our recipe tester's grandmother Josephine Rege has been making her version of lemon angel pie for more than 60 years. We updated her recipe, and the result became an instant Martha (and test-kitchen) favorite.This recipe is one of our Better Basics: 10 New Takes on Family Favorites, see the others.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Pie & Tarts Recipes
Time 12h
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Crust: Preheat oven to 300 degrees with rack in center. Lightly brush a 9-inch pie plate with butter. Whisk together egg whites and 1 tablespoon cold water with a mixer on high speed until foamy, about 30 seconds. Add cream of tartar and continue to beat until soft peaks form, about 1 minute. Gradually add sugar and beat until thick, glossy peaks form, about 5 minutes.
- Transfer egg-white mixture to prepared pie plate; spread along bottom and up sides to form crust. (Don't spread past rim of pan.) Bake meringue until crisp and light golden on outside, about 40 minutes. Turn off heat and let cool in oven 1 hour, then transfer to a wire rack and let cool completely.
- Filling: Meanwhile, whisk egg yolks in a medium saucepan (off heat) until thickened and pale yellow, 1 to 2 minutes. Whisk in sugar and lemon zest and juice. Place over medium heat and cook, stirring constantly with a wooden spoon, until mixture is very thick, about 10 minutes. Transfer to a large bowl. Cover with plastic wrap, pressing it directly onto surface of curd. Refrigerate until thoroughly chilled, at least 1 hour and up to 1 day.
- Whisk curd until smooth. Whip cream with a mixer on high speed until soft peaks form, about 30 seconds. Working in batches, gently fold whipped cream into curd. Fill meringue crust with lightened curd; smooth top. Refrigerate, loosely covered, at least 8 hours and up to 1 day.
- Topping: Whip cream and sugar with a mixer on high speed until stiff peaks form, about 40 seconds. Spread over pie. Finely grate lemon zest over top. Slice with a chef's knife, wiping blade between cuts, and serve.

CLASSIC SUNSET HOLIDAY DISHES: LEMON ANGEL PIE
From sunset.com
3/5 (46)Servings 6Cuisine Australian, New ZealandCalories 329 per serving
- Preheat oven to 275°. Generously butter a 9-in. pie pan, preferably glass, and set aside. In bowl of a stand mixer, whip egg whites on high speed until frothy. Sprinkle with cream of tartar and whip until whites hold a soft peak when whisk is lifted. Gradually rain in 1 cup of the sugar (2 tbsp. every 20 seconds), until whites are glossy; hold a stiff, straight peak when whisk is lifted; and no longer feel grainy between fingers, 5 to 6 minutes total.
- Scrape meringue into pan. With back of a soup spoon, create a tall pie shell: Spread meringue fairly flat on pan bottom and then swirl it 1 to 1 1/2 in. above and just inside rim rather than on it, since meringue will expand over rim as it bakes. Bake just until surface of meringue feels crisp and dry in center and is barely starting to color, 40 to 45 minutes. Crust will be fragile and layer underneath will be soft and moist. Let cool on a wire rack.
- In a medium metal bowl, whisk egg yolks, the remaining 1/2 cup sugar, zest of 3 lemons, and lemon juice until blended. Set over a pan filled with 1 in. simmering water and cook, whisking constantly, until curd thickly coats a metal spoon and reaches about 180° on an instant-read thermometer (tip bowl to check), 8 to 11 minutes. Set bowl in a larger bowl of ice and water and let cool, whisking often; chill until used.
- Whip cream until thick. Stir a spoonful into lemon curd, then fold in the rest. Spoon mixture into meringue shell, swirling top. Chill at least 2 hours to mellow. Scatter long lemon zest strands on top if you like. MAKE AHEAD Chilled airtight up to 1 day.
